PVAL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review
382 institutional investors reported a position in Putnam Focused Large Cap Value ETF (PVAL)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$10B — up 35% from $7.45B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 89 funds opened new PVAL positions and 18 closed out — a net gain of 71 holders — while 207 added to existing stakes and 61 trimmed.
The largest buyer was LPL Financial, adding an estimated $434M. The largest seller was Piedmont Capital Management (Montana), exiting entirely with an estimated $22.8M sold.
